How to use pearl cotton hot melt adhesive? High pressure polyethylene polyurethane foam is a kind of non chemical closed cell structure, also called EPE pearl cotton, which is a new environmental protection packaging product. It consists of thousands of individual bubbles made of high pressure polyethylene grease through physical polyurethane foam. The conventional polyurethane foam cotton is easy to break, deform and recover.
Hot melt adhesive is used for high-end fragile gift box packaging, metal products, small toys, fruits and vegetables, leather shoe packaging, daily necessities, as well as express packaging bags for car seat cushions, pillows, electronic appliances, instrumentation equipment, computers, speakers, medical machinery, industrial control cabinets, hardware accessories, lighting fixtures, artworks, laminated glass, porcelain, household appliances, spray painting, furniture, alcohol and epoxy resin, and other products. After adding colored anti-static agents and halogen-free flame retardants, its extraordinary characteristics are displayed. Not only does it have an exquisite appearance, but it also effectively avoids static electricity induction and ignition. Pearl cotton hot melt adhesive, the key is to use EPE pearl cotton for bonding.
Pearl cotton hot melt adhesivePerformance steps:
In the actual performance of pearl cotton hot melt adhesive, the key points to consider are: the place of use should be naturally ventilated and avoid using fire. Avoid contact between melted raw materials and eyes and skin; If the melted material comes into contact with the skin, immediately soak the skin in water or wash it with cold water. After the water cools down, remove the adhesive, wipe the swollen area with methyl silicone oil, and seek medical treatment.

For EVA hot melt adhesive used for binding, it can be divided into high-speed adhesive and low-speed adhesive according to different curing times. The curing speed of high-speed adhesive is slightly faster, while the curing speed of low-speed adhesive is slightly slower.
